    THE PROPERTY NERDS: How education and teamwork unlock faster results

    In this episode of The Property Nerds, co-hosts Arjun Paliwal and Adrian Lee from InvestorKit are joined by mortgage broker Sarah McConville from Fouracre Financial to share how the right team drives property investment success.


    sarah mcconville spi z6felv

    Sarah emphasises that relying on experts, rather than attempting to navigate investments alone, is critical for investors, similar to not going to a friend for medical surgery.

    Sharing her personal journey, she recounts buying her first home at 22 and facing financial stress after a relationship breakdown, highlighting the importance of stability and support during challenging times.

    Sarah explains that her move into mortgage brokering is driven by a passion for helping others achieve home ownership and build wealth, reflecting her commitment to guiding clients through complex financial decisions.

    The episode also highlights the role of education, particularly for female investors, who benefit from proactively learning about property investment to make informed choices.

    She stresses that some women may not be as engaged in financial decisions as they should be, which can create challenges during unexpected life events.

    Sarah further notes the value of a well-rounded team – including accountants, buyer’s agents, and financial advisers – to navigate market trends and achieve investment goals efficiently.
